Engine Specs
Geared up with a durable layout, the VQ35 engine in the Nissan Murano offers a mix of power and efficiency that improves the SUV's performance. This 3.5-liter V6 engine is engineered with an aluminum alloy block and aluminum DOHC (Dual Overhead Webcam) cylinder heads, adding to its lightweight qualities while guaranteeing toughness. The VQ35 engine supplies a maximum output of approximately 245 horsepower at 6,000 RPM and a torque ranking of around 246 lb-ft at 4,400 RPM, promoting solid velocity and responsiveness.
Including innovative innovations, the VQ35 includes continual variable shutoff timing (CVVT) on both the intake and exhaust sides. This technology enhances engine performance throughout different RPM varieties, enhancing both power delivery and gas performance. In addition, the engine utilizes a multi-port gas shot system, ensuring exact gas atomization for enhanced burning.
The VQ35 is mated to a continually variable transmission (CVT), which supplies smooth gear changes and improves driving convenience. In general, the specifications of the VQ35 engine exemplify Nissan's dedication to performance and integrity, making it an important feature for the Murano SUV.

Reliability and Maintenance
Dependability is an extremely important factor to consider for SUV owners, and the VQ35 engine in the Nissan Murano shows a solid track record hereof. This engine, known for its robust building and engineering excellence, has gathered beneficial evaluations from both consumers and automobile professionals alike. With a layout that emphasizes sturdiness, the VQ35 has revealed durability versus usual wear and tear, adding to its reputation as a reliable powertrain.
Routine upkeep is necessary to ensure the durability of the VQ35 engine. Routine oil adjustments, normally advised every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, are important for preserving optimum performance and stopping engine wear. In addition, checking coolant degrees and replacing the timing belt at the specified intervals can significantly enhance the engine's integrity.
While the VQ35 has less reported concerns contrasted to some competitors, it is not unsusceptible to potential obstacles, such as oil leakages or sensing unit failures. However, aggressive upkeep and dealing with minor problems quickly can alleviate these concerns. Overall, the VQ35 engine stands out as a trusted choice for SUV fanatics looking for efficiency and comfort in their car
